K. Fichtner is a scholar working on Plant Science, Molecular Biology and Soil Science. According to data from OpenAlex, K. Fichtner has authored 8 papers receiving a total of 709 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Plant Science, 4 papers in Molecular Biology and 1 paper in Soil Science. Recurrent topics in K. Fichtner’s work include Photosynthetic Processes and Mechanisms (4 papers), Light effects on plants (3 papers) and Plant nutrient uptake and metabolism (3 papers). K. Fichtner is often cited by papers focused on Photosynthetic Processes and Mechanisms (4 papers), Light effects on plants (3 papers) and Plant nutrient uptake and metabolism (3 papers). K. Fichtner collaborates with scholars based in Germany, United States and United Kingdom. K. Fichtner's co-authors include Ernst‐Detlef Schulze, Mark Stitt, Steve Rodermel, Lawrence Bogorad and Harold A. Mooney and has published in prestigious journals such as PLANT PHYSIOLOGY, The Plant Journal and Oecologia.
